- Fixup / remove obsolete comments.
- ktrace no longer requires Giant so do ktrace syscall events before and after acquiring and releasing Giant, respectively. - For i386, ia32 syscalls on ia64, powerpc, and sparc64, get rid of the goto bad hack and instead use the model on ia64 and alpha were we skip the actual syscall invocation if error != 0. This fixes a bug where if we the copyin() of the arguments failed for a syscall that was not marked MP safe, we would try to release Giant when we had not acquired it.
